Word Meaning 花火
はなび
hanabi
花火 is read as はなび (hanabi) and means fireworks.

Max. 12Example Sentences
10花火を見た?
Did you see the fireworks?
花火が見える!
I see fireworks!
すごい花火だ!
These fireworks are spectacular!
昨日の花火見た?
Did you see yesterday's fireworks?
彼らは花火を打ち上げた。
They set off fireworks.
そのお祭りは花火とかあるの?
Are there going to be fireworks and stuff at that festival?
豪快な花火を打ち上げました。
They set off fireworks with a great bang.
花火っていつからあるんですか?
Since when have there been fireworks?
あそこなら花火が見やすいよ。
It's easy to see the fireworks from over there.
私たちは花火大会に行きました。
We went to a firework festival.
